Lumbres (French pronunciation:[lœ̃bʁ];West Flemish:Lumeres) is acommune in thePas-de-Calaisdepartment in the Hauts-de-Franceregion of France[3] at the junction of the valleys of the riversAa andBléquin, about 6 miles (10 km) southwest ofSaint-Omer.

History

[edit]

Evidence of prehistoric occupation, at the place known as theMontagne de Lumbres has been discovered by.[5] Pontier andCanon Collet, of the abbey of Wisques, who were the first to study the prehistory of the area, includingArques,Elnes and Wavrans.
Because of its industrial importance, and proximity to fortifiedV2 sites, the commune suffered heavily fromAllied bombing duringWorld War II.

Transport

[edit]

TheChemin de fer d'Anvin à Calais (CF AC) opened a railway station at Lumbres in 1881.[6] The CF AC was closed in 1955.[7] Lumbres station is also on theBoulogneSaint-Omer line.
